National LISC and the Greater Newark & Jersey City Program have developed a myriad of opportunities for community development practitioners to have access to resources that will enhance CDCs capacity to build healthy communities.
National LISC's LISC Online Resource Library website has in-depth information and educational opportunities
covering topics such as affordable housing, social & economic development, land use and
organizational development and planning. The LISC Online Resource
Library also provides policy news, funding opportunities and web
links for community development practitioners.
Also, National LISC's Experts Online Series, an interactive forum for professional discussion among industry experts, as well
as national and local practitioners affords community development practitioners an opportunity to train with experts and learn from their peer's experiences from across the country. The online presentation coupled with the conference call allows participants to hear the expert(s) speak, view the corresponding visual presentation in real
time, and pose written or oral questions to the speaker(s) during the event. The Series is made possible through a partnership with KnowledgePlex.org
